The complete instruction manualLonicera nigra carries — its genome. We read it from three angles — how big it is, how the DNA is packed into chromosomes, and how completely it has been sequenced — and explain how to read each value as you go.
Genome sizehow big the whole instruction manual is
Genome size684 600 000 bp
Measured in base pairs (bp) — the individual letters of DNA (human ≈ 3.2 Gb, a bacterium a few million). The chart places this genome on a logarithmic scale — each step to the right is ten times bigger — among reference organisms. Across species a bigger genome loosely tracks with larger cells, slower growth and lower-energy lifestyles (powered flight favours small genomes) — yet it does not imply more genes or a more advanced organism (the long-standing C-value paradox).

Chromosomes & ploidyhow the DNA is packaged
2n is the full chromosome count in a normal body cell; n is a gamete (egg or sperm), which carries half. Ploidy is how many complete chromosome sets each cell holds — 2× (diploid) is typical for animals, while higher levels (polyploidy) are common in plants.
